Transaction 64b93bc72fee07215031e026b73a37eba5462ae8f43764321e4d51a2b1c306c7
2 Input
2 Outputs
- 64b93bc72fee07215031e026b73a37eba5462ae8f43764321e4d51a2b1c306c7:0
- 64b93bc72fee07215031e026b73a37eba5462ae8f43764321e4d51a2b1c306c7:1
value 425070
address 1PM5JfJAvSTFHMuBrnFGZSNzg2SWnuwuxC
value 934160
address 38AwCgvt1AxTfgjjNxZQXH1XAiJrGi5Aqn